I have a sneaking suspicion that Chow Bella readers don’t really need an excuse to eat Vietnamese cuisine, but just for fun, why not celebrate the lunar new year at Mekong Plaza’s Tet Festival this weekend?
The Mesa Vietnamese shopping center (66 S. Dobson) is already home to a handful of delicious restaurants (read the review I wrote last year), and the festival will feature authentic Vietnamese eats as well.
While you’re busy nibbling and wandering, check out live taiko and other musical and comedy performances, a Texas hold ’em poker tournament, carnival rides, a photography exhibit, fashion shows, and a health fair.
Festivities take place from 5 to 10 p.m. tonight (carnival rides and games), and from 10 a.m. to 10 p.m., Saturday and Sunday.
